Getting a student's authorization Getting a learner's license is a crucial step in New York's Graduated Driver Licensing (GDL) program. It permits beginner drivers to practice driving under particular conditions and ensures that they acquire experience in a safe environment. During this procedure, it's essential to comprehend all the rules and requirements. To help you start, we've compiled an extensive guide to the process. To obtain a learner's authorization, you must be at least 16 years of ages and supply a number of types of paperwork. These include proof of identity and age, together with a completed application type. You likewise need to pass a written understanding test and a vision examination. You can get ready for these tests by studying the New York state driver's handbook and taking practice tests. The practice tests will assist you acquaint yourself with the format and type of questions you'll come across on the real test. As soon as you have passed all of the requirements, you will be issued a temporary learner's permit that allows you to drive while supervised by a certified driver. Taking a pre-licensing course Taking a pre-licensing course is an important action in ending up being a safe driver. It assists drivers comprehend the importance of defensive driving and how alcohol and drugs impact driving skills. In addition, trainees learn to acknowledge and manage their feelings when driving. This can avoid road rage and aggressive driving habits. The pre-licensing course also covers the impact of speeding and sidetracked driving on road safety. The class is taught by an authorized trainer and may be provided in a classroom or online. The course curriculum is divided into several units, which concentrate on different subjects. nytt körkort borttappat of these consist of: driver practices and abilities, highway transportation systems, and driving laws. Some courses may have an evaluation at the end to help trainees evaluate and enhance essential ideas. New York needs all new drivers to take a 5-hour pre-licensing course before arranging their roadway test for their first license. The course can be taken in individual at a regional high school or college, or it can be finished online through a licensed service provider. Regardless of the format, a trainee needs to have a valid New York State student permit to take the course. After completing the course, a trainee's conclusion info will be sent out to the NYSDMV. It examines your knowledge of traffic laws and driving methods. It consists of 20 multiple-choice questions that cover numerous topics, such as roadway signs, standard car controls, and safe driving laws. A score of at least 80% is required to pass the test. To get ready for the exam, you need to study your driver's handbook and take practice tests. You can find a totally free New York driver's manual online or at any DMV workplace. In New York, you should have a minimum of 20/40 vision (with or without contacts) and a driver's education certificate, if you are under 18. The test is administered by a skilled evaluator and involves driving on city streets and highways. The evaluator will provide you instructions throughout the test, and it is necessary to listen thoroughly. You ought to always request clarification if you're puzzled. Some directions are time-sensitive, so it's crucial to pay attention.
